Fig. (6) Explanation. Sacubitril/valsartan contains valsartan and sacubitril (neprilysin inhibitor) = LBQ657. Neprilysin changes ANP, BNP, CNP, adrenomedullin, substance P, bradykinin, angiotensin II, etc., into inactive fragments, whereas Sac/Val increases them. On the other hand, angiotensin long blockade induces aldosterone through the aldosterone breakthrough and increases the blood pressure. Increased aldosterone and blood pressure cause renal tubule fibrosis, glomerular fibrosis and injury, and sacubitril/valsartan decreases them.
